EVR Hedge Fund Activity: Q2 2021 in Review

428 of the 5,745 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in Evercore (EVR) for Q2 2021, worth a combined $5.02B — up 1.9% from $4.92B a quarter earlier.

Buyers outnumbered sellers: 68 funds opened new EVR positions and 48 closed out — a net gain of 20 holders — while 124 added to existing stakes and 180 trimmed.

The largest buyer was Lord, Abbett & Co, opening a new position worth an estimated $58.5M. The largest seller was Jane Street, exiting entirely with an estimated $83.8M sold.
